Exit 9 Capital Centre Gridlock Tops Nairobi Morning Traffic Update as Outering Road Crawls

Motorists heading towards Nairobi’s Industrial Area and the Central Business District experienced slow-moving traffic on Wednesday morning, with Exit 9 at Capital Centre emerging as one of the city’s most congested traffic hotspots.

Traffic data showed that vehicles approaching and exiting the busy interchange were moving at an average speed of 12 km/h, resulting in significant delays for commuters using the route during the morning rush hour.

The congestion at Exit 9 comes as thousands of motorists travel between Mombasa Road, the Southern Bypass, and Nairobi’s CBD, making the interchange one of the capital’s busiest transport corridors.

Elsewhere, Outering Road recorded the slowest traffic movement of the morning, with vehicles reduced to bumper-to-bumper conditions and average speeds of just 9 km/h. The heavy congestion is expected to increase travel times for motorists using the route to connect to eastern parts of Nairobi.

Traffic remained moderate on several other major roads across the city.

Along Jogoo Road, motorists experienced moderate congestion with average speeds of 18 km/h, while Lunga Lunga Road recorded relatively smoother traffic, averaging 20 km/h despite increased commuter activity.

Meanwhile, Manyanja Road also experienced moderate traffic flow, with vehicles travelling at an average speed of 16 km/h.

Road users travelling through these corridors are advised to plan for longer journey times, particularly those heading towards Capital Centre, the Industrial Area, and connecting routes feeding into Nairobi’s Central Business District.

Traffic conditions are expected to remain dynamic throughout the morning as commuter volumes continue to build.
